Golden Beet Salad with Goat Cheese and Walnuts
A bright and refreshing salad featuring roasted golden beets, creamy goat cheese, crunchy walnuts, and a tangy balsamic vinaigrette over peppery greens.

Ingredients 4 medium golden beets 4 cups mixed greens 4 ounces goat cheese 1 cup walnuts 1 small red onion thinly sliced 3 tablespoons olive oil 1 tablespoon balsamic vinegar Salt and black pepper to taste
Preheat oven to 400°F. Scrub and trim beets, wrap in foil, and roast for 45–60 minutes until fork-tender.
Let beets cool slightly, peel, and slice into rounds or wedges.
Toast walnuts in a dry skillet over medium heat for 3–5 minutes until fragrant. Set aside.
In a small bowl, whisk olive oil, balsamic vinegar, salt, and pepper.
Arrange greens on a serving dish. Top with beets, goat cheese, red onion, and walnuts.
Drizzle with vinaigrette and gently toss to coat before serving.
